A town has two shopping malls. A survey conducted on the shopping preferences of the town's residents showed that 62% of the residents visit Comet Mall, 73% of the residents visit Star Mall, and 48% of the residents visit both malls.
The probability that a resident chosen at random shops at either Comet Mall or at Star Mall is
%.?
PLZ help what is the percent??

Answers

Given:

62% of the residents visit Comet Mall.

73% of the residents visit Star Mall.

48% of the residents visit both malls.

To find:

The probability that a resident chosen at random shops at either Comet Mall or at Star Mall.

Solution:

Let A be the event that the residents visit Comet Mall and B be the event that residents visit Star Mall. Then, we have

[tex]P(A)=62\%[/tex]

[tex]P(B)=73\%[/tex]

[tex]P(A\cap B)=48\%[/tex]

We need to find the probability that a resident chosen at random shops at either Comet Mall or at Star Mall. It means, we have to find the value of [tex]P(A\cup B)[/tex].

We know that,

[tex]P(A\cup B)=P(A)+P(B)-P(A\cap B)[/tex]

On substituting the given values, we get

[tex]P(A\cup B)=62\%+73\%-48\%[/tex]

[tex]P(A\cup B)=87\%[/tex]

Therefore, the probability that a resident chosen at random shops at either Comet Mall or at Star Mall is 87%.

Answer: 87%

What are fossils?

Fossils are the preserved remains, or traces of remains, of ancient organisms. Fossils are not the remains of the organism itself! They are rocks. A fossil can preserve an entire organism or just part of one.

Fossils give scientists clues about the past. For this reason, fossils are important to paleontology, or the study of prehistoric life. Most fossils are found in earth that once lay underwater.
